Pros & Cons

Auto-generated from official data — head-to-head differences and gaps vs the national average.

Las Cruces, NM
Pros
Homes cost $388k less ($197,200 vs $584,700)
Rent averages $1222/mo less ($907 vs $2,129)
Commutes run 9 min shorter each way
13% cheaper overall cost of living than Stamford
Milder winters — January highs near 59°F vs 38°F
Living costs sit below the national average (index 93.8)
Cons
Median income trails Stamford by $49,705/yr
Violent crime (720.0/100k) is above the U.S. average of 380
Property crime (4873.4/100k) runs high vs the U.S. average
Higher unemployment (7.5% vs 5.5%)
Stamford, CT
Pros
Households earn $49,705 more per year on average
78% less violent crime than Las Cruces
Violent crime is well below the national average (157.5 vs 380/100k)
Stronger job market — unemployment is 2.0 pts lower (5.5%)
More college-educated — 50.4% hold a bachelor's or higher
Cooler summers — July highs near 85°F vs 96°F
Cons
Pricier housing — median home is $584,700
Higher rents — median is $2,129/mo
Cost of living runs 13% higher than Las Cruces
Longer commutes — 27.8 min average each way
